What Nir Eyal Taught Us About Habits, Beliefs, and Human Connection Nir Eyal is a bestselling author, behavioral design expert, and lecturer at Stanford’s Graduate School of Business. His books Hooked (2014), Indistractable (2019), and Beyond Belief (2026, NYT bestseller) explore how habits form, how to manage attention, and how limiting beliefs keep people stuck. He has appeared on The Art of Charm podcast twice, discussing how these principles apply directly to building stronger relationships and social skills. Nir Eyal has been on The Art of Charm twice now. The first time, back in Episode 431, we talked about the Hook Model: how technology hijacks your attention through triggers, variable rewards, and investment loops.
